## Step 4: Enable trace propagation

Quick heads-up for security review: Lattermile's services pass trace context via signed headers, so the collector can stitch requests across the payments and inventory meshes. Nothing sensitive rides in the span names themselves — we scrub those at ingest. The tracer does need the signing secret available at boot, though. Add the following line to the deploy env file:

sealed setting: ARCHIVE_KEY3=8d0

Welcome to the SDK team. We ship two clients for the Lanternwire API: the Swift SDK and the Kotlin SDK. Feature parity is tracked in the parity matrix spreadsheet, updated every sprint. New features must land in both SDKs within one release cycle. If you spot a parity gap, report it to the SDK leads.

escalation mailbox, kagep-tawef: ulawyn_norius_gordor@paliqlabs.corp

Handover note — config hot-reload, Veldmere platform

For the release manager: I'm handing hot-reload ownership from myself (Tomas) to Priya before the 4.2 cut. The watcher service now reloads routing and feature-flag configs without restarts; validation runs before swap, and a bad config rolls back automatically. One caveat: if the watcher itself wedges, you must restart it via the sealed admin console. That console prompts for the recovery passphrase on first unlock, so keep the following on hand.

strongbox words: zorath-holmir

**Handover: Stagewright Seat-Map Renderer**

Support team — I'm handing over the renderer that draws seat maps for the Orlenne Playhouse booking site. Most tickets you'll see are about seats rendering in the wrong tier color or the balcony layer failing to load; both are almost always config issues, not code bugs. The renderer reloads its config every two minutes, so fixes take effect quickly. Before escalating anything, compare the live values against the canonical set below.

service settings:
[casax]
port = 6379
team = rusir
host = casax.zemvarhq.corp
region = outer-4
access_code = ac_9808ce
timeout_ms = 1500

Q: Can I use the goods lift at Pelton Yard? A: Only if you're moving actual deliveries — it's reserved for couriers and facilities, so no sneaky shortcuts with your lunch. If you do have a legit bulky delivery to move, book a slot with the post room first. The lift panel is code-locked, and the current access code is:

door code, tahof-yajog: bdg-C-65